Texas: Our Unrealized Dream

Deni And I bought some property in Texas in 2007. The property is 40 miles north of Houston in the Sam Houston National Forest. It is in a development of about 4500 acres and is very rural. We have 3.25 acres.

Our plan was to build on our property and retire in Texas. It was a really fun time because we had a new vision we were pressing toward. We made at least one trip a year and met a lot of our new neighbors by organizing summer picnics and maintaining An online message board for the community.

But alas when the housing bubble burst, we lost the equity in our home here in Seattle. Our plan was to sell and use the equity to build in Texas. Our in-laws bought the property next-door to us and we were going to live as neighbors. Well their plans also changed and they didn’t build. We couldn’t afford to build. So the plan went by the wayside and our dream was unrealized.
